Rick Owens Spring 2023 Menswear

This Rick Owens show was the end of the world. Or at least that is what the three 2-meter-ish across orbs that were set alight by technicians, slowly lifted by crane high above us, and then dropped to a sizzling impact in the Palais de Tokyo fountain were there to represent.

John Elliott Spring 2023 Menswear

As menswear springs back from its comfort-centric pandemic years, brands that thrived selling loose, effortless clothes are grappling with how to evolve. John Elliott took his show to Paris for the first time in a long time, explaining over Zoom that “you take showing in Paris with a level of focus and respect.”

Erdem Spring 2023 Menswear

Beautiful young men standing in an English country garden, against beds of succulent purple and yellow flag irises. Erdem Moralioglu, with his cinematic eye for glancingly historical biographical references, almost conjured a reincarnation of an everyday scene from the country life of the painter and plantsman Cedric Morris for his summer menswear collection.

Rolf Ekroth Spring 2023 Menswear

For the past few years Rolf Ekroth has been going it alone in more ways than one, working solo in a small studio in Helsinki and trying to get his nascent brand off the ground without backing. Spring finds the designer ebullient, having very much enjoyed the company of his four collaborators.

Pitti Uomo Street Style 2022

Pitti Uomo is back and the streets of Florence, Italy are more stylish than ever. Pitti Uomo occurs twice a year, once in the winter and then again in the summer. Manufacturers and brands related to menswear or lifestyle products descend upon Florence to showcase the season's collections.

HYPEBEAST TO DEBUT A MULTIFACETED FLAGSHIP BUILDING IN NYC

Hypebeast, a leading global platform for contemporary culture and lifestyle, and a premier destination for editorially-driven commerce and content, will unveil its first-ever U.S. flagship building in the heart of Manhattan's Chinatown on 41 Division Street this week. Spanning seven floors, the approximately 25,000 square-foot space will house all facets of Hypebeast's ecosystem under one roof, including the HBX New York flagship store, Hypebeans café, event spaces, as well as an office headquarters.
